Update on PyRads Experiment

Well, 7487 of the 8000 PyRad impressions I got (a $10 value!) for paying for Blogger Pro have yielded thus far a single clickthrough, around the first time the ad went live. I know in direct-mail marketing a 2% return is considered pretty good, but what about a 0.013% clickthrough rate?
